Default PC tower + HFS+ firewire drive + 003 = errors

So I've got a PC with only 1 firewire port. I daisy chained a mac HFS+ Avastore HDX firewire drive and 003 factory in the following configuration: tower-drive-003 and am having all kinds of issues. (Mac drive support is on there). Basically when I tried to start a new session on the drive pro-tools wouldn't load and froze so I had to restart the computer. Now I'm getting dialogues that say the mac volume "may be damaged" followed by "the disk structure is corrupted and unreadable". So I was wondering:

a) whats the best way to repair the drive? (it's new and I don't have to worry about losing the few files on there).
b) which startup items/services need to be running for mac drive support?
c) what can I do to make this work...?

Any help would be greatly appreciated. Thanks.

Default Re: PC tower + HFS+ firewire drive + 003 = errors

Quote:
Originally Posted by thibault View Post
a) whats the best way to repair the drive? (it's new and I don't have to worry about losing the few files on there).
When this happens you're supposed to plug the drive into a mac and run the disk utility.

Quote:
c) what can I do to make this work...?
Don't use Macdrive for running the PT session on a pc. You're not the first person to have this problem. There is no known solution. The work-around is to drag the sessions off the HFS+ drive onto an NTFS drive while working on a pc and drag it back to the HFS+ drive when you want to transfer back to the mac.
